Attributor Integrates Creative Commons with Text Fingerprinting
The text fingerprinting provider Attributor launched a beta version of a service called FairShare last week. FairShare enables anyone with an RSS feed — bloggers, for example — to attach Creative Commons noncommercial licenses to their content and use Attributor’s technology to track where their content is to be found on the web. Amazon Launches Kindle Reader App for iPhones
Today Amazon is launching Kindle for iPhone and iPod Touch, an e-book reader application, available in the iPhone App Store at no charge.
